Sangrar párrafo en Word con la API REST de Python

Este artículo explica cómo aplicar sangría a un párrafo en Word con la API REST de Python. Aprenderá a añadir una sangría francesa en Word con la API REST de Python usando el SDK de Python en la nube. Se explicarán diversas opciones de formato junto con el código de ejemplo.

Requisito previo

  • {{HIPERVÍNCULO1}}
  • Descargue SDK de Aspose.Words Cloud para Python para agregar sangría francesa en un archivo de Word
  • Configurar el proyecto de solución Python con el SDK anterior para sangrar párrafos

Pasos para sangrar la primera línea de un párrafo con Python Low Code API

  1. Cree una instancia de la clase WordsApi para sangrar párrafos utilizando el ID del cliente y el secreto
  2. Cargue el archivo Word de origen en una matriz de bytes para sangrar el texto seleccionado
  3. Cree un objeto de la clase ParagraphFormatUpdate y establezca la sangría deseada
  4. Cree el objeto UpdateParagraphFormatOnlineRequest utilizando los archivos de Word de entrada/salida y los parámetros de formato
  5. Llame al método ActualizarFormatoDePárrafoEnLínea() para sangrar el párrafo deseado
  6. Guarde el flujo de salida de la respuesta de la API en un archivo local en el disco

Los pasos mencionados describen cómo añadir sangría francesa en Word con la API REST de Python. Comience el proceso cargando el archivo de Word de origen, creando los cambios de formato deseados con el objeto ParagraphFormatUpdate, creando la solicitud con el objeto UpdateParagraphFormatOnlineRequest y sangrando los párrafos con el método UpdateParagraphFormatOnline. Finalmente, guarde el archivo de Word de salida después de añadir la sangría en línea al archivo cargado.

Código para sangrar párrafos con la API de Python Low Code

El código de ejemplo muestra cómo aplicar sangría en Word con la API REST de Python. Si desea una sangría francesa, configure el parámetro FirstLineIndent con un valor negativo; de lo contrario, configure un valor positivo en puntos para agregar la sangría de primera línea. Puede usar otros parámetros de formato, como alineación, interlineado, sombreado, etc., en la clase ParagraphFormatUpdate para actualizar los archivos de Word en línea.

En este tema, aprendimos a sangrar párrafos. Si quieres aprender a insertar un párrafo en un archivo de Word, consulta el siguiente artículo: Insertar párrafo en Word con la API REST de Python.

 Español